What is a public‐key infrastructure (PKI)? The comprehensive system required to provide public‐key encryption and digital signature services is known as a public‐key infrastructure. The purpose of a public‐key infrastructure is to manage keys and certificates. By managing keys and certificates through a PKI, an organization establishes and maintains a trustworthy networking i i bli h d i i h ki environment. A PKI enables the use of encryption and digital signature services across a wide variety of applications.

Federal Small Business Reporting
electronic Subcontracting Reporting System (eSRS) electronic Subcontracting Reporting System (eSRS)
The use of eSRS promises to create higher visibility and introduce a more transparency into the process of gathering information on federal subcontracting accomplishments As part of the President'ss federal subcontracting accomplishments. As part of the President Management Agenda for Electronic Government, the Small Business Administration (SBA), the Integrated Acquisition Environment (IAE), and a number of Agency partners collaborated to develop the next g yp p generation of tools to collect subcontracting accomplishments. This government‐wide tool is known as the eSRS. This Internet‐based tool will streamline the process of reporting on subcontracting plans and provide agencies with access to analytical data on subcontracting performance.
